126 volunteers to conduct voter education program in Kailali

२०८२ फाल्गुन १, ०६:५३ Dineshkhabar Desk

Dhangadhi: A total of 126 volunteers will be mobilized to carry out a voter education program across Kailali. The Election Office announced that one volunteer will be assigned to each of the 126 wards within all 13 municipalities of the district.

Rajesh Chaudhary, Information Officer of the Provincial Election Office, stated that the selected volunteers include women working in fields such as health, social work, and community services. Each volunteer will be responsible for setting goals and providing voter education in their respective wards.

The program will cover topics such as the validity of votes and proper voting procedures. Volunteers will also be provided with sample ballot papers to assist in educating voters at their workplaces.

According to the Election Office, the voter education program is scheduled to run from Falgun 3 to 17.
